From 1848 to 1850 Liszt wrote three piano pieces that were published at the end of 1850 under the title Liebesträume - 3 Notturnos. The composition reworks three songs written between 1843 and 1850 which were also published by Kistner in that year. The first two, "Hohe Liebe" and "Gestorben war ich/Seliger Tod," are set to a poem by Ludwig Uhland (1787-1862): a favorite German poet of the 19th century. The third, "O lieb, so lang du lieben kannst!" is set to text by Ferdinand Freiligrath (1810-1876) who was an active poet and translator. Two earlier versions and a later version of Notturno No. 2 were composed from 1845 to 1846, 1848 to 1849, and 1865 respectively. These variousversions are also included in this edition.
